Frequently Asked Questions about STD Testing in Okmulgee
How do I know if I might have an STD?
How do I know if I might have an STD?
Possible signs of an STD may include:
- Unusual discharge from the genitals
- Pain or burning during urination
- Itching or irritation in the genital area
- Pain during intercourse
- Sores or bumps around the genitals or mouth
- Flu-like symptoms such as fever or body aches
If any of these symptoms are experienced, consultation with a healthcare professional is recommended.
When should I get tested after exposure?
When should I get tested after exposure?
Testing timelines differ according to the infection:
- Chlamydia: 1-2 weeks
- Gonorrhea: 1-2 weeks
- HIV: 2-4 weeks for initial testing (follow-up at 3 months)
- Syphilis: 3 weeks
- Herpes: 2-12 weeks depending on the type
Getting tested at the appropriate time is crucial for accurate results.
What does a comprehensive STD test panel include?
What does a comprehensive STD test panel include?
A comprehensive STD test panel typically includes testing for:
- Chlamydia
- Gonorrhea
- HIV
- Syphilis
- Herpes Type 1 and Type 2
- Trichomoniasis
This panel ensures broad coverage for common sexually transmitted infections.
